Heriberto González: A Visionary Explorer of Cosmic Landscapes Heriberto González (born March 23, 1959) stands as a singular figure in contemporary Cuban art—a testament to the enduring power of surrealism infused with scientific observation. Born in Havana, Cuba, González’s artistic journey began amidst a backdrop of intellectual curiosity and fascination for the cosmos, influences that would profoundly shape his distinctive visual language.
